在选择虚拟主机时,了解其支持哪些类型的数据库是至关重要的。不同的数据库系统具有各自的特点和适用场景。目前,大多数虚拟主机通常支持以下几种常见的数据库:MySQL、MariaDB、PostgreSQL、SQLite等关系型数据库,以及MongoDB、Redis等非关系型数据库(NoSQL)。
如何选择最适合的数据库
1. 考虑应用程序需求
首先要考虑的是您的Web应用程序或网站的需求。如果您的应用主要涉及大量结构化数据的存储和查询,并且需要事务处理功能,那么关系型数据库(如MySQL、MariaDB、PostgreSQL)将是更好的选择。如果您正在构建一个需要快速读写操作的应用程序,例如社交网络、实时分析平台或缓存系统,可以考虑使用非关系型数据库(如MongoDB、Redis)。对于小型项目或者个人博客来说,SQLite是一个轻量级且易于部署的选择。
2. 性能与可扩展性要求
性能和可扩展性也是选择数据库时的重要因素之一。对于高并发访问的应用,您可能需要一个能够处理大量连接并提供良好响应时间的数据库。随着业务增长,当面临数据量激增时,所选数据库是否容易扩展也变得非常重要。例如,在水平扩展方面,某些NoSQL解决方案可能会比传统的关系型数据库表现更好。
3. 成本效益分析
成本也是一个不可忽视的因素。不同类型的数据库在许可费用、硬件资源消耗等方面存在差异。开源数据库(如MySQL、PostgreSQL)通常不需要额外支付软件授权费,而商业数据库(如Oracle)则可能带来更高的开销。在预算有限的情况下,建议优先考虑那些性价比高的选项。
4. 技术团队熟悉度
最后但同样重要的是要考虑技术团队对各种数据库系统的熟悉程度。如果开发人员已经具备了丰富的经验和知识,那么选择他们擅长的数据库将有助于提高工作效率,减少学习曲线带来的风险。相反地,如果团队成员对该领域不太了解,则需要投入更多时间和精力进行培训和技术研究。
在选择最适合虚拟主机环境下的数据库时,应该综合考虑应用程序的具体需求、性能与可扩展性要求、成本效益以及技术团队的经验等多个方面。通过权衡这些因素,您可以为自己的项目挑选出最合适的数据管理系统。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/197706.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。